Clarkston High School Lacrosse

Boys Varsity Lacrosse 2011 - Go Wolves!

The 2011 Lacrosse Season will begin with the first practice on March 15th.   Our program has the opportunity to become one of the top teams in our Region.  We cannot achieve success without complete dedication from the coaches, players and their families.     Unfortunately, Spring Break is held the week of April 4th – which is a crucial point in our schedule.   Therefore we are making plans to keep our team competitive during this week.   We want to make sure that everyone is clear on the plans and expectations for 2011 Spring Break April 4-8.

Varsity players will be having practice and possibly games the week of spring break.  We are looking into a few different options:

Disney option:

Disney’s Wide World of Sports Complex

We would travel to Orlando Florida and stay at a Disney Caribbean Beach Resort. 

The package includes a four night stay and a 3 day park hopper pass

Players would be provided breakfast each day

The team would receive a one hour training clinic with Casey Powell (Syracuse and MLL Lacrosse superstar)

Unlimited practice team time we want to schedule.

All Transportation to and from the fields and to the parks

Cost (NOT INCLUDING GETTING TO ORLANDO) $499 per person ($125 per night)

We are working with a travel agent to find inexpensive flights for the trip.

We would not require players to fly, families or parents may drive provided the players were at the resort at the scheduled time and day

Ohio option

We would be traveling to Southern Ohio or Indiana

Travel would be by bus

We would stay in hotels along the route

Games would be played and practices would be held (where possible)

This trip would be much like the 2010 trip

 

Stay Home option

Stay home and hold practice and games

 

We are currently looking at all options and are trying to provide the best opportunity and experience for our team.   All family members are invited to join the varsity team on any of the trips that we make.  We welcome your input on which option you would prefer. 


Obviously the first two options have financial requirements and we are exploring several fundraising events.  While we cannot guarantee that the fundraising efforts will completely offset the cost, the amount raised will help.  Amount earned for your trip would be dependent on your participation.  Currently we have scheduled a Night at Culver’s – (Wednesday, July 14th 4 – 9 pm).   We are also investigating two dates for weekend car washes.   More information for both events will be provided as soon as the plans are confirmed.  

 

Travel participation will NOT determine whether or not you will be selected to a Varsity team.  However, Varsity must have 100% participation in whatever option is chosen.  If we are unable to have 100% participation in our travel plans, our only option would be to stay in Clarkston during break and hold practices/scrimmages locally.   If you intend to tryout for the Varsity team, you should consider participating in the fundraising events to offset any cost for travel.
